Statins and the Long War Against Atherosclerotic Risk

The story of statins is really the story of medicine learning to fight a slow enemy before it becomes a sudden one. Atherosclerosis does not usually arrive as a cleanly visible disease in its early stages. It accumulates across time, shaped by lipids, inflammation, metabolic stress, blood pressure, smoking exposure, genetics, and the small injuries of daily biology. By the time plaque announces itself through angina, stroke, or heart attack, the war has already been underway. Statins became central because they allowed clinicians to enter that war earlier and with more consistency than previous generations could manage. 🫀

What makes this “long war” language fitting is that no single pill conquers atherosclerotic disease in total. Statins reduce risk, often substantially, but they do not repeal age, erase every plaque, or neutralize all other contributors to vascular injury. They belong to a campaign rather than a cure. The arterial system is influenced by years of diet, glucose handling, smoking, kidney health, physical activity, stress, sleep, and inherited susceptibility. A statin can shift the terrain, but it is part of a larger strategy aimed at keeping unstable plaque from becoming clinical disaster.

This longer perspective is useful because the public conversation about statins often becomes too compressed. Supporters may speak as though the drugs are obviously beneficial for everyone with an abnormal lipid panel, while skeptics may react as though the benefits are exaggerated or mostly theoretical. The truth is more measured and more medically useful. Statins are powerful tools for many patients, especially those with established cardiovascular disease or clearly elevated risk, but their value depends on context, baseline danger, and the quality of the conversation that led to treatment.

Why atherosclerosis is such a difficult opponent

Atherosclerosis is difficult because it is often silent, systemic, and cumulative. It does not always stay confined to one vessel bed. The same general disease process that narrows coronary arteries may also affect the carotids, peripheral arteries, and microvascular health. A patient may live with no symptoms until a plaque ruptures, a clot forms, or progressive narrowing crosses a threshold the body can no longer compensate for. That hidden progression is precisely why prevention matters. Once tissue has died during a major infarction or stroke, medicine can help, but it cannot simply rewind the injury.

Statins work in this setting not because they make arteries young again, but because they influence a central driver of plaque formation and instability. Lowering LDL cholesterol reduces one of the core substrates from which plaque develops. Over time, that can reduce the likelihood of future events. In clinical practice, the benefit is especially meaningful for people who have the most future disease to prevent: those with prior cardiovascular events, diabetes, familial lipid disorders, or multiple major risk factors acting together.

It is also why statins are often underappreciated by healthy-feeling patients. The disease they are targeting is invisible until it is not. When the enemy is silent, the treatment can feel abstract. A patient who feels well may understandably ask why they should take a medication for years when nothing currently seems wrong. That is not ignorance. It is a normal human reaction to delayed risk.

Prevention requires patience

Patience is one of the most underrated elements of cardiovascular care. Patients want to know whether a treatment is “working,” yet the truest answer often appears over years in the form of events that never happen. The chest pain that never develops, the catheterization that never becomes necessary, the stroke that never interrupts speech or mobility, the emergency that never arrives in the middle of the night. Preventive medicine lives in the invisible success of avoided outcomes.

That invisibility creates a burden on explanation. Clinicians have to translate risk into something emotionally intelligible without turning the conversation into fear tactics. Numbers matter, but numbers alone rarely persuade. Patients need help understanding how their age, family history, blood pressure, diabetes status, smoking exposure, and lipid profile work together. A treatment makes more sense when it is tied to a believable personal story rather than delivered as a generic rule.

This is also where lifestyle and medication should be kept together. A statin is not proof that food, activity, sleep, and tobacco exposure no longer matter. In fact, the opposite is true. The more serious the cardiovascular risk profile, the more important it becomes to layer strategies. Why the debate around statins persists

The debate persists partly because statins are prescribed so commonly. Any therapy given to millions of people will attract skepticism, media simplification, and stories of both success and frustration. Common side effects or perceived side effects become culturally amplified. At the same time, public distrust of medical institutions can turn nuanced risk-benefit discussions into absolute positions. One patient feels better informed by treatment. Another feels medicalized by it. Both reactions shape the conversation.

Medicine responds best when it neither dismisses concerns nor abandons evidence. Muscle symptoms deserve to be heard. Questions about whether the expected benefit is large enough deserve a real answer. The possibility that one statin or dose may be less tolerable than another deserves flexibility. Yet it is equally important not to let cultural fatigue obscure the reality that atherosclerotic disease remains a leading cause of death and disability. The danger is not imaginary simply because the treatment is common.

In high-risk patients especially, the cost of abandoning therapy without good reason can be serious. The absence of immediate symptoms does not prove absence of benefit. That is the central paradox of prevention. What patients most want to feel is often not what preventive medicine can offer directly. What it offers is altered probability, and altered probability matters profoundly when the event being prevented is catastrophic.

How statins relate to later intervention

Many people incorrectly imagine a split between medical therapy and procedures, as though one route belongs to pills and the other to “real treatment.” In truth, statins remain important even when disease progresses to intervention. A patient may eventually need a stent or bypass surgery because plaque has produced serious narrowing, unstable symptoms, or an acute coronary event. That does not make the statin irrelevant. It usually makes the larger preventive strategy more urgent.

Opening or bypassing a blocked artery can be lifesaving or symptom-relieving in the right context, but the vascular biology that created the problem still has to be managed afterward. The war against atherosclerosis is not won by one dramatic procedure. It is managed through continuity.

There is also an important moral point here. Patients should not be blamed when long-term disease eventually requires more aggressive treatment. Prevention lowers risk; it does not create invincibility. The proper measure of therapy is not perfection, but whether it meaningfully shifts the course of disease.

Why the long war still matters

Statins still matter because the burden of vascular disease remains immense and because atherosclerosis continues to reward delay with sudden consequences. The drugs are not glamorous. They do not feel curative. They require adherence in a culture that prefers immediate proof. Yet they remain one of the clearest examples of modern medicine thinking ahead instead of simply reacting after damage is done.

In that sense, statins represent a hard but necessary truth about health: the body is often shaped more by what accumulates slowly than by what appears suddenly. Treating that kind of danger requires discipline, perspective, and a willingness to act before catastrophe provides emotional certainty. That is why statins remain central to the long war against atherosclerotic risk.

Why plaque biology matters beyond the cholesterol number

Another reason statins matter in the long war against atherosclerosis is that clinicians are not thinking only about the number printed on a lab report. They are thinking about plaque behavior. Not all arterial narrowing carries the same immediate danger. Some plaques remain relatively stable for long periods, while others are more vulnerable to rupture and clot formation. The patient may feel no warning before that rupture turns silent disease into infarction or stroke. A treatment that helps shift plaque biology toward greater stability therefore has significance beyond simple arithmetic reduction in LDL.

This is one reason the drugs remain central even when patients ask whether their cholesterol is “that bad.” The visible lab value matters, but the clinical concern is broader: what kind of vascular future is being built over time? Atherosclerosis is not merely a measurement problem. It is a tissue problem unfolding inside vessels the patient cannot inspect or feel. Statins belong to the long war because they target that hidden terrain before catastrophe exposes it.
